I've finally finished reading Pope Leo,s recent 'Magnifica Humanites' and I agree pretty much with most of it, even though l am a staunch atheist, as some of the points l have been arguing myself for years, as in how to support possibly 50% of the population who may lose their jobs. He writes about (amongst other things) humanity, what it means to be human, how to help the less fortunate in society as AI completely changes the world, and how it shouldn't be up to the tech bros to decide mankind's future. It's great that his message will reach billions of people, but as to what effect it will have in the long run, l'm not so sure. Also, l love the coded messages to Trump and his cronies. He's the kind os Socialist leader l am after (but minus the faith).
